Why Family Conflicts Can Escalate
Situations like this are unfortunately not rare. A 2024 study by the National Family Preservation Network reported that around 30% of CPS cases are triggered by family disputes or misunderstandings, rather than genuine abuse.
Sometimes family members misinterpret discipline, illness, or parenting struggles as neglect. Other times, emotions like jealousy, resentment, or anger can cloud judgment.
Family therapist Dr. John Gottman, writing in a 2023 Psychology Today article, explained: “Rebuilding trust after betrayal requires accountability and open dialogue, but safety comes first.” For this mother, the safety of her children had to take priority over repairing her relationship with her sister.
